2008 cash-at-judge’s-door case: Former HC judge Nirmal Yadav acquitted

  • Nirmal Yadav was acquitted in the 2008 cash-at-judge’s-door case by a special CBI court in Chandigarh.
  • The case involved Rs 15 lakh allegedly meant as a bribe delivered mistakenly to another judge.
  • Special CBI judge Alka Malik stated that false allegations had been levelled against Nirmal Yadav.
  • Justice Yadav maintained her innocence throughout, stating that there was nothing incriminating found during the entire trial against her.
